Aprende a programar: Consejos para aprender cómo programar

La codificación informática y la programación son unas de las habilidades de mayor demanda en el mundo moderno. Los codificadores y programadores se necesitan por casi cualquier compañía que tenga una app, un sitio web o cualquier hardware ejecutado por un sistema informático. Para lograrlo, sólo aprende a programar para convertirte en uno.

Con el incremento de la popularidad de programación, son cada vez más las personas intentando aprender cómo programar. Preguntas como ¨¿Cómo comenzar a programar?¨ y ¨¿Cómo programar desde cero?¨ se están convirtiendo en algunas de las búsquedas más populares en Google, demostrando su popularidad. Sin embargo, incluso pensar en aprender a programar podría ser un reto para los novatos.

Pero, ¿en dónde comenzar?

Bueno, al final de este artículo tendrás una respuesta completa. Para comenzar, vamos a contestar una pregunta muy importante - la cual muchas personas son incapaces de contestar. ¿Qué es la programación?

¿Qué es la programación?

Antes de que comiences tu camino para convertirte en un programador experto, tienes que entender algo: exactamente qué es programar.Ahora, si le preguntaras esto a alguien en la calle, te daría alguna respuesta imprecisa sobre cómo usar computadoras y crear juegos.

El Cupón Coursera más Reciente Encontrado:

Esto no está tan mal, pero es una forma simple de explicar lo que es la programación. La programación es esencial en la vida moderna porque es el fundamento de todo desde computadoras y autos hasta teléfonos inteligentes. Sin esta, mucha de la tecnología que conocemos no existiría y el mundo sería un lugar diferente.

Aprende a programar en tu tiempo libre y podrás utilizar tu nuevo conocimiento en lo siguiente:

  • Desarrollo web back-end. Esto se hace con lenguajes como PHP o Java y controla cómo responde una página web a ciertas acciones.
  • Desarrollo web front-end. Se logra con lenguajes como HTML, CSS y JavaScript y controla cómo se ve una página web.
  • Desarrollo de aplicaciones móviles, realizado con algo como Swift (para dispositivos Apple) o Java.
  • Análisis científico de datos, se utiliza por investigadores o sus asistentes utilizando programas desarrollados con Python.

Estos son algunos de los trabajos básicos para programadores principiantes. Aprende a programar y adquiere más experiencia para llegar a hacer tareas avanzadas como sistemas autopiloto de ingeniería aeronáutica, crear computadoras de autos de conducción autónoma o incluso trabajando con la NASA - ¡el potencial es ilimitado!

learn coding

¿Por qué debería aprender a programar?

Muchos programadores nuevos que buscan cómo programar para principiantes no confían en sí mismos y su habilidad para convertirse en un programador real. Lo más difícil al aprender a programar son las primeras semanas, al principio será difícil seguir lo que haces, no podrás escribir ningún programa y probablemente tendrás problemas siguiendo ejercicios simples o tutoriales.

Sin embargo, aprende a programar sin dudar de tu capacidad. Investiga y aprende cómo programar. Sigue los consejos de los expertos y busca cursos de programación que se enfoquen en principiantes. Algunas de las razones más importantes para aprender a a programar incluyen:

  • Serás capaz de crear tu propia aplicación o sitio web. Esto tiene el potencial de abrirte las puertas a oportunidades laborales en línea.
  • De repente tendrás más oportunidades laborales. Incluso si la industria en la que trabajas no requiere que sepas de programación, aprende a programar y elevar tu empleabilidad. Esto podría ofrecerte nuevas oportunidades laborales o ascensos, acelerando tu carrera.
  • Podrías comenzar una nueva carrera. La programación es una de las profesiones de mayor demanda en el mundo. Esto significa que hay mucho trabajo para los programadores y es posible ganar muy buen dinero como desarrollador o programador.
  • Aprenderás a aprender. Aprender cómo programar requiere mucha atención a detalle, precisión y lo más importante, compromiso. Si puedes aprender un lenguaje de programación de manera exitosa, será mucho más fácil aprender nuevas habilidades en el futuro.

Como puedes ver hay muchas razones para aprender a programar. Aprende a programar y no sólo ten más oportunidades de trabajo y seguridad laboral, también vas a aprender una nueva habilidad y ser capaz de comenzar tu propio negocio en línea si quieres.

¿Qué lenguaje de programación aprender primero?

Hay literalmente cientos de programas diferentes. Muchos de estos tienen casos de uso específicos y son difíciles de aprender, lo que significa que no son ideales para principiantes que quieren aprender cómo programar por primera vez.

Sin embargo, hay algunos lenguajes populares de programación que son fáciles de aprender, conocidos y tienen un gran número de casos de uso. Estos lenguajes generalmente tienen una sintaxis simple, comunidades enormes en línea y se leen casi como el inglés. Aprende a programar uno de los mejores lenguajes de programación que existen como:

JavaScript

Javascript es seguramente uno de los lenguajes de programación de mayor demanda y más conocidos. Aunque no es el lenguaje de programación más fácil, su versatilidad y la demanda por programadores competentes lo hace un excelente lenguaje para quienes quieren aprender a programar. Algunas de las razones por las cuales JavaScript está a la cabeza de nuestra lista de los mejores lenguajes de programación para aprender primero son:

  • Es muy conocido:

JavaScript está en todas partes. Ha sido utilizado tradicionalmente para el desarrollo front-end de sitios web, pero en los últimos años se ha vuelto cada vez más popular entre los desarrolladores back-end. Prácticamente cualquier persona con un sitio web o una aplicación tendrá al menos algo de código JavaScript que necesita ser mantenido o actualizado de vez en cuando, por lo que siempre habrá trabajo para los desarrolladores.

  • Ha crecido bastante recientemente:

Mientras más personas buscan las respuestas a preguntas como "¿Cómo comenzar a programar?" y "¿Cómo programar desde cero?", la comunidad JavaScript ha crecido rápidamente. Mientras más usan el lenguaje, la cantidad de herramientas para los desarrolladores va incrementando rápidamente también, lo que significa que hay muchas cosas distintas para las que puedes usar JavaScript.

  • La demanda por desarrolladores es enorme:

Como mencionamos antes, JavaScript está en todos lados. Aunque hay muchas personas aprendiendo el lenguaje últimamente, la demanda por programadores con experiencia es inmensa. Aprende a programar y disfruta de la demanda en el mercado laboral, dándote la flexibilidad de elegir cuándo y dónde trabajar.

  • Aprenderlo no es muy difícil:

Claro seguramente no es el lenguaje más fácil, pero tampoco el más difícil. Una vez que entiendas algo de su sintaxis y cómo funciona la programación, JavaScript, aprenderas a programar en poco tiempo. Si quieres darle una oportunidad, dirígete a BitDegree. Aquí encontrarás varios cursos JavaScript para elegir. Si eres un principiantes, puedes comenzar con el Vídeo Tutorial JavaScript, el cual te proporcionara una detallada introduccion al lenguaje y como utilizarlo correctamente. Si quieres aprender JavaScript a través de la practica, el Tutorial Interactivo JavaScript entra más en detalle y te brindara un amplio rango de habilidades y conocimiento al finalizar el curso.

Python

Python es sin duda uno de los mejores lenguajes cuando se trata de programación para principiantes. Es el lenguaje más popular enseñado en escuelas alrededor del mundo, probablemente debido a su versatilidad y simplicidad. Python ha crecido increíblemente en el 2017, colocándolo junto a JavaScript en términos de popularidad. Esto sugiere que seguirá siendo un lenguaje relevante - y excelente para aprender - para los años que vienen.

Aprende a programar Python y disfruta de los beneficios al aprenderlo por primera vez:

  • Es muy simple y fácil de seguir, siendo ideal para principiantes sin experiencia en programación.
  • Se lee como el inglés, lo que hace fácil de aprender su sintaxis y aprender a corregir errores.
  • Es muy versátil, permitiéndote expandir tu conocimiento en campos como desarrollo web, creación de aplicaciones e incluso análisis científico de datos.

Python es uno de los lenguajes preferidos por académicos y otras personas trabajando en la ciencia, se usa para escribir análisis básicos de datos o monitorear programas, lo que significa que aprender Python básico es una gran idea si eres un investigador.

También se utiliza mucho en nuevos campos como inteligencia artificial y aprendizaje automático, dos de las industrias más crecientes en los últimos años. Si te interesa la nueva tecnología y la llegada de IA, aprende a programar Python, un excelente lenguaje para aprender por primera vez.

BitDegree ofrece varios cursos de Python, el Curso Python básico te enseñarán los fundamentos del lenguaje y su sintaxis. Si buscas algo mas avanzado, Aprender a hacer estructuras de datos con Python y Reconocimiento de imágen con Python, te enseñarán algunas de las aplicaciones prácticas del lenguaje y cómo puede ser utilizado en el mundo real.

HTML

HTML es probablemente el lenguaje de programación más fácil y es una excelente opción para personas que no saben mucho de tecnología pero quieren aprender a programar. Aunque es simple, HTML se usa mucho en gestión de contenido y diseño web. Junto con CSS, es esencial para cualquiera que quiera un trabajo como desarrollador front-end, entonces ¿por qué no aprenderlo primero?

Incluso si no quieres aprender programación formalmente. HTML puede ser muy útil, por ejemplo, si tienes tu propio sitio web o blog y escribes código regularmente, podrías requerir de formato personalizado para tu contenido. Esto sería difícil sin conocimiento de HTML, deberías intentar y aprenderlo. Algunas ocasiones en las que podrías utilizar HTML incluyen:

  • Si necesitas personalizar una plantilla. HTML se utiliza en muchos correos electrónicos. Saber algo de HTML te permitirá personalizar plantillas de correos que utilizas en tus negocios.
  • Para crear enlaces internos.Un entendimiento de código HTML y cómo funciona te permitirá crear enlaces internos en tu contenido, es muy útil cuando escribes largas piezas con muchas sub categorías.
  • Para personalizar tu contenido.Entender HTML te permitirá cambiar fuentes, controlar ubicación de imágenes y el tamaño de la fuente al publicar nuevo contenido.

Como puedes ver, HTML es ideal para quienes quieren aprender a programar pero les falta algo de confianza. Si te agradó, entonces dirígete a BitDegree y echa un vistazo al Curso HTML5 básico y al Tutorial HTML y CSS de Space Doggos. Ambos te darán una introducción al lenguaje enseñándote sus conceptos principales, y dándote la información más importante para que decidas si quieres aprender más.

Java

El último lenguaje en nuestra lista es Java, uno de los lenguajes de programación más populares a nivel mundial. Se utiliza para un rango amplio de tareas, desde desarrollo web back-end hasta ingenierías de software, y es popular para quieres quieren aprender programación para principiantes.

Diseñado originalmente como una alternativa de C++, Java es ahora muy conocido en el mundo de la programación informática. La mayoría de las grandes empresas utilizan Java para crear sus aplicaciones de escritorio y back-ends de sus sitios web. Java es compatible en múltiples plataformas a través de Java Virtual Machine (JVM), que lee y ejecuta código Java. La mayoría de las aplicaciones Android fueron creadas con Java.

Como puedes ver, los casos de uso de Java son muy variados. Esto fortalece su posición como un excelente lenguaje cuando inicias tu aprendizaje de programación. Es un lenguaje de alto nivel, lo que se refleja en su sintaxis y convenciones simples. Está diseñado para principiantes que no tienen mucha experiencia en programación, lo que significa que es robusto y puede a veces ejecutar código incluso con pequeños errores.

La desventaja de Java es que requiere mucho código para crear algo que valga la pena. Lo que lo hace menos gratificante para las personas que iniciar su camino en la programación, Sin embargo, es escalable, rápido y en demanda.

Si piensas que Java es perfecto para comenzar, aprende a programar con los cursos de programación ofrecidos por BitDegree. Si eres un principiante, el Curso Java básico es una excelente opción. Te enseñará cómo programar con Java, lo que puedes lograr con Java y los fundamentos básicos de programación.

¿Qué pasos debo tomar al aprender a programar?

Aprender cómo programar podría ser difícil y confuso para muchas personas, especialmente quienes no tienen experiencia con tecnología. Hay algunas cosas que debes hacer antes de comenzar tu camino para convertirte en programador y hacer la experiencia de aprendizaje algo más fácil y satisfactorio, incluyendo:

  1. Comienza analizando por qué quieres aprender a programar

Si no te has preguntado por qué quieres aprender a programar, es tiempo de contestar la pregunta. Las razones por las que quieres aprender a programar reflejarán qué lenguaje de programación aprender, el tiempo que invertirás aprendiendo y el tipo de cursos que tomarás. Pregúntate lo siguiente:

  • ¿Qué ganarás al aprender a programar?
  • ¿Quieres una carrera como programador?
  • ¿Qué tan comprometido estás para aprender un nuevo lenguaje de programación?

Contestar a estas preguntas te ayudarán a iniciar tu comienzo aprendiendo programación.

  1. Una vez que sepas por qué quieres programar, elige un lenguaje.

De nuevo, necesitas saber por qué quieres aprender a programar antes de decidir qué lenguaje de programación aprender. El lenguaje perfecto según tus necesidades depende exactamente de lo que quieres obtener de tu experiencia de aprendizaje.

Por ejemplo, aprende a programar Swift si quieres ser un programador iOS, aprende a programar con uno de los lenguajes mencionados anteriormente si quieres trabajar en desarrollo web, o aprende a programar con Solidity si quieres convertirte en un ingeniero blockchain.

  1. Ventajas
    • Professional service
    • Flexible timetables
    • A variety of features to choose from
    Características Principales
    • Professional certificates
    • University-level courses
    • Online degree programs
    Ventajas
    • Easy to use
    • Offers quality content
    • Very transparent with their pricing
    Características Principales
    • Free certificates of completion
    • Focused on data science skills
    • Flexible learning timetable
    Ventajas
    • Simplistic design (no unnecessary information)
    • Good quality of courses (even the free ones)
    • A few different features to choose from
    Características Principales
    • Nanodegree Program
    • Suitable for enterprises
    • Paid Certificates of completion

    Comienza con algo sencillo y no esperes demasiado

La programación es como cualquier otra habilidad. No esperes iniciar y aprender cómo crear tus propias aplicaciones y sitios web en un par de horas. Desafortunadamente, toma un poco más desarrollar las habilidades necesarias para ser un más o menos, buen programador.

Una vez que hayas identificado por qué quieres aprender a programar y lo que esperas obtener de esto, ¡elige un lenguaje y aprende a programar de inmediato!

Recursos para aprender a programar

Sólo porque te has registrado a un curso en línea o un tutorial, no significa que no puedas utilizar otros recursos para profundizar tu aprendizaje. Hay miles de recursos distintos, como sitios web, foros de discusión, aplicaciones y tutoriales. Algunos de los recursos más populares para aprender programación incluyen:

  • Aplicaciones sencillas de programación.Con el auge de programación, hay un mayor número de aplicaciones disponibles para ayudarte a aprender. Mientras que muchas se dirigen a niños, podrían ser una manera efectiva de ayudarte a entender conceptos difíciles.
  • Usa sitios de aprendizaje en línea gratuitos.Sitios como BitDegree, ofrecen una gran variedad de cursos gratuitos y de pago diseñados para ayudarte a aprender un nuevo lenguaje. ¿Y la mejor parte? Si no dispones de los recursos suficientes para costear un curso, puedes solicitar una beca para clases en línea.
  • Revisa algunos libros, claro, seguramente piensas que estamos en la era digital y que los libros de texto son cosa del pasado, pero en realidad siguen siendo relevantes. Si de verdad quieres aprender a programar, toma un libro que resuma los fundamentos básicos del lenguaje que aprendes.

Estos son algunos de los recursos alternativos que existen para quienes aprenden cómo programar. Con una sencilla búsqueda en Google encontrarás muchos más. ¡Aprende a programar más fácilmente con la ayuda de estos recursos y tu curso de programación!

Es tiempo de aprender a programar

Aprender a programar y la programación informática son dos de los pasatiempos más populares actualmente alrededor del mundo. Mientras que la programación es más popular, muchos encuentran dificultad al tomar los primeros pasos, aprender un nuevo lenguaje puede parecer abrumador al principio.

Aprende a programar sin problemas leyendo el artículo completo que hemos presentado. Claro, aprende a programar iniciando con un lenguaje popular y sencillo como Python, Java, JavaScript o HTML, toma tu tiempo y recuerda - aprender programación no es algo que pase de la noche a la mañana. Requiere esfuerzo y lo más importante, compromiso.

Déjanos tu más sincera opinión

Déjanos tu mas sincera opinión y ayuda a miles de personas a elegir la mejor plataforma de aprendizaje online. Todas aquellas opiniones, tanto positivas como negativas, son aceptadas siempre y cuento sean honestas. No publicamos opiniones sesgadas o spam. Si quieres compartir tu experiencia, opinión o dejar un consejo. ¡El telón es tuyo!

Preguntas mas frecuentes

¿Cómo eligen que plataformas de cursos online analizar?

Elegimos las plataformas de aprendizaje online de acuerdo con el tamaño de su mercado, popularidad y, lo que es más importante, la petición o el interés general de nuestros usuarios de leer reseñas MOOC genuinas sobre ciertas plataformas.

¿Cuanta información recolectan antes de elaborar una reseña?

Nuestros expertos llevan a cabo investigaciones durante semanas, sólo entonces pueden decir que sus evaluaciones de los diferentes aspectos son definitivas y concluyentes. Aunque lleva mucho tiempo, es la única manera de garantizar que todas las características esenciales de las plataformas de aprendizaje online son genuinas. Cabe destacar que nuestro veredicto se basa en datos reales.

¿Qué aspecto es el más importante al elegir las mejores plataformas de aprendizaje online?

No sería correcto elegir sólo un aspecto: las prioridades dependen de cada persona, valores, deseos y objetivos. Una característica que es importante para una persona puede ser totalmente irrelevante para la otra. De todas formas, todos los usuarios estarían de acuerdo en que la buena calidad del material de aprendizaje es una necesidad indiscutible.

¿Qué tan diferentes son sus reseñas de las demas disponibles en Internet?

Cada una de las reseñas MOOC es única y tiene sus propios objetivos y valores. Nuestras reseñas son 100% genuinas y se elaboran tras un cuidadoso análisis. Este es el objetivo del que carecen muchos otros sitios de revisión, ¡Por lo que lo consideramos nuestro súper poder!

Días
Horas
Minutos
Segundos